новое событие
Информационный поток
Задания вакансии материалы разработки сообщения форума
Wesley
Приватное сообщение

Исправить работу внешних обработок для 1С УТ 11.4 и 11.5

5883 |  4
вчера в 17:11:40 (11 часов назад)
998210
Текст задания
Исходные данные:
1. Файлы внешних обработок для 1С УТ 11.4 и 11.5. (во вложении)

Суть работы механизма, для общего понимания, заключается в следующем:
Программа, с учетом настроек установленных пользователем на форме внешней обработки, обращается запросом к регистрам базы данных (Выручка и себестоимость продаж, Товары на складах) и выводит из них данные в Ексель файлы, записывая последние на диск копмьютера. Формат файлов Ексель и формат данных организован строго по шаблону.

Что нужно исправить:
1. Срочно.
При установке флага "Выводить себестоимость по нормативному виду цен"
Программа должна выводить в колонку "себестоимость" файла "продажи" значения выбранного вида цены. Берем последнее значение в выгружаемом месяце (период выбранный на форме может быть выбран и больше месяца - 2,3, 6 и.т.д. месяцев) Нужно брать последнее значение цены в каждом месяце выбранного периода. Если значения в этом месяце нет, то берем последнее существующее ранее месяца выгрузки.


2. Не срочно.
На форме обработки Есть флаг "Учитывать товары в резерве"
Если флаг включен, то в файл "остатки товаров" нужно выводить количества по всем товарам за минусом всех резервов. То есть только свободные остатки.
Этот механизм сейчас работает "криво". Проблема в том, что на большой базе клиента механизм выгрузки повисает и база перестает отвечать.
Его нужно переделать, взяв данные по резервам из регистра "Свободные остатки" или аналогичного.

Первое если есть возможность нужно сделать сегодня и для обработки для УТ 11.4
Второе в обычном порядке.
0
Отклики (4)